Abstract

An internal peeping detection-while-drilling system includes an intelligent probing rod, cable drill pipes, a signal relay sub, a ground control terminal, a data interpretation and goaf reconstruction imaging software system, and a remote data transmission system, where the intelligent probing rod includes an up-down separated protective transmission mechanism and an instrument cabin; the intelligent probing rod includes a lower end connected to a drilling bit, and an upper end connected to each of the cable drill pipes; the instrument cabin is provided in the up-down separated protective transmission mechanism, and provided with a sonar-lidar-audio/video sensor assembly; the cable drill pipes are connected to each other to form a cable and data transmission channel; the signal relay sub is provided between the cable drill pipes at intervals; and an uppermost end of the cable drill pipe is connected to the ground control terminal.
